FLU 2026/2027

Our main Flu vaccination programme is due to start mid October.  Eligibility criteria will be as follows:

• pregnant women (September)
• all preschool children aged two to four years on 1 September 2026 (September)
• all school-aged children (up to and including year 12) September
• all children in clinical risk groups aged from 6 months to less than 18 years (September)
• all those aged 65 years and over on 31 March 2027
• all those aged 18 years to under 65 years in clinical risk groups (as defined by the influenza chapter in ‘Immunisation against infectious disease’ (the ‘Green Book’)
• all health and social care workers1
• those in long-stay residential care homes
• carers
• close contacts of immunocompromised individuals
• high risk poultry and avian animal health workers2
• high-risk cattle and swine workers3
• rough sleepers and homeless hostel users

Please note that the criteria for Flu and Covid vaccinations are not the same this year.
